摘 要:随着航空电子显控系统的日趋繁杂,如何正确分析航空电子显控系统的原始自然语言需求成为需求分析领域中急需解决的问题.本文基于形式化转换规则的需求规范化方法,对航空电子显控系统的原始自然语言需求进行规范化分析与研究.工作主要包括:对于不同的自然语言需求,符号化定义需求语句结构.针对自然语言需求语句当中经常出现的歧义、模糊、不可验证等问题,根据不同的需求语句模式设计出不同的转换规则.同时,为实现自然语言需求到规范化需求的自动转换过程,本文借助Stanford Parser词法分析器,输出不同需求语句的语法树,并结合相应的转化算法输出规范化需求语句.最后通过实例验证了基于形式化转换规则的规范化方法在航空电子显控系统的自然语言需求领域中具有较好的有效性和实用性.With the increasing complexity of display and control systems of avionics,how to correctly analyze the natural language requirements of display and control systems of avionics has become an urgent problem to be solved in the field of analysis of requirements.Based on the requirements specification method of formal transformation rules.this paper conducts a standardized analysis and research on the natural language requirements of display and control systems of avionics.Mainly including:Faced with different natural language requirements,symbolize the structure of demand sentences.For the ambiguities,fuzziness,and unverification that often appear in natural language requirement statements,according to different patterns of natural language requirement,different transformation rales are proposed.At the same time,in order to realize the automatic transformation process from natural language requirements to standardized requirements,this paper uses the Stanford Parser lexical analyzer to get the syntax trees of different requirements sentences,and combines the corresponding transformation algorithms to receive the standardized requirements sentences.Finally,an example is carried out to verify that the normalization method based on formal transformation rales has good effectiveness and practicality in the field of natural language requirements of display and control systems of avionics.
关 键 词:自然语言需求 形式化转换规则 规范化需求 规范化方法
